Last week, the Probo Medical team attended MEDICA 2021 in Dusseldorf, Germany from November 15th to the 18th. Team members from the Indiana and Tampa office joined forces with the European teams to represent Probo Medical at the world's largest convention for the world of medicine. Our international experts made new friends at the Probo Medical booth where visitors could participate in daily giveaways, enjoy refreshments, and watch equipment demonstrations as they learned about the company.

The Probo team was able to share the new rebrand and present Probo Medical’s wide range of comprehensive diagnostic service offerings. We demonstrated some of our available ultrasound machines to prospective customers, including a Philips Epiq 5, GE Voluson S8, and the Samsung Medison RS80. Our teammates did a fantastic job scheduling meetings with many new and existing customers who were attending the event, many being back-to-back all day long. Although attendance dropped due to concerns about COVID, our booth was full of activity from the beginning to finish of the show. As expected, people who came to the show were there to do business, so our conversations were very productive.

MEDICA 2021 was a huge success for Probo Medical as we received hundreds of visitors to our booth during the four day medical trade fair. “MEDICA was a great success for our team! Not only did we have one great conversation after another with customers, we were able to unite as a global team to represent Probo Medical on a big stage for the first time. I was very impressed with the level of professionalism and dedication to the event by each of our teammates,” said Probo Brand Manager Hayley Brown. Probo Medical intends to participate in MEDICA 2022 and many more to come so that we can expand our offers of the highest quality refurbished ultrasound systems and C-arms at the best prices across the globe.
